Analysis

In 2018, norway — paper and paperboard, excluding newsprint — export quantity in Denmark stood at 8,636 t.

That represents a change of down 13.6% on the previous year and up 31.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, norway — paper and paperboard, excluding newsprint — export quantity in Denmark peaked at 38,077 t in 1998 and was at its lowest, 2,729 t, in 2013.

Denmark ranks 5th of 47 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
